Existential Import
In logic, the assumption that a statement implies the existence of the subject it mentions.
I Proposition
An I proposition in traditional logic is an affirmative particular statement, indicating that some members of the subject class are included in the predicate class, typically structured as "Some S are P."
Enthymeme
A rhetorical syllogism used in arguments, often with one premise left unstated but implied.
Temperament
The inherent part of an individual's personality that influences how they interact with their environment and regulates their emotions.
